Submit your app for review

Learn how to submit your Android app to Stripe.

After you finalize your app, you must submit it to Stripe for app review. You can upload your app using the Stripe Dashboard.

Make sure to follow the app review guidelines to help with a timely and successful review. For example, verify the instructions that you intend to provide for the Stripe reviewer. Following your instructions to make sure they’re complete can help prevent failing the app review.

Upload your app

  1. In the Stripe Dashboard, click Developers > Apps.
  2. On the Terminal apps tab, click Create app.
  3. In the App information window, enter the name of your app and the package name, then click Create app.
  4. Complete the following steps in the Upload your APK window:
    • Choose the compatible devices for your app.
    • Upload your APK file.
    • Add instructions for the Stripe reviewer.
    • Enter the email address where Stripe can send updates about your app review. You can enter one or multiple email addresses.
    • Click Submit for review.

Monitor the review status

After you submit your app for review, you can monitor the following for status updates:

Delivery methodDescription
EmailStripe sends an email notification of your app review results to the email address you provided during submission.
DashboardYour app review status appears on the app details page.

Webhook

Stripe sends a webhook to your webhook endpoint:

  • terminal.device_asset_version.app_review_approved - Stripe approves your app for deployment.
  • terminal.device_asset_version.app_review_rejected - The app reviewer couldn’t approve your app. You must fix the problem and resubmit your app for review.

You can find all webhook events on the Events page.
